Job description
One of our clients are seeking a Senior SAP PM / S/4HANA Consultant to support their transformation towards a modern, digital maintenance organization. In this role, you will analyze current business processes, define future requirements, and ensure that maintenance, inventory management, spare parts, procurement, master data, and asset structures are effectively supported in SAP S/4HANA. You will act as the key link between business stakeholders, IT, and project teams, ensuring that future solutions are aligned with operational needs and industry best practices.
Key Responsibilities Analyze current maintenance and asset management processes. Perform GAP analyses between the existing SAP environment and future SAP S/4HANA solutions. Gather, document, and validate business requirements.
Design and optimize processes across:
- Maintenance Operations
- Preventive Maintenance
- Spare Parts Management
- Warehouse Operations
- Material Management
- Procurement Processes
- Service Contract Management
Review and improve:
- Equipment Structures
- Functional Locations
- Bills of Material (BOMs)
- Material Master Data
- Maintenance Plans
- Spare Parts Structures
Support data cleansing, migration, testing, and user acceptance activities. Drive process harmonization and standardization. Support organizational change and user adoption. Provide recommendations for future governance, processes, and system architecture.
Requirements
- Minimum 6 years of SAP PM / EAM experience.
- Proven experience with SAP S/4HANA transformation or migration projects.
- Strong knowledge of maintenance and asset management processes.
- Experience with SAP MM and procurement integration.
- Experience in master data and BOM management.
- Experience working in manufacturing, heavy industry, energy, or process industries.
- Fluent in English, both written and spoken.
